Haytor Terrace is in Newton Abbot and in Teignbridge district. TQ12 1EY is located in the College elect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Newton Abbot.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ding TQ12 1EY,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.2%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around TQ12 1EY,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 46.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Haytor Terrace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Haytor Terrace was 93.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 184.0% higher than the Ambrook average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Haytor Terrace has the 12th highest crime rate of 63 local areas in Ambrook and the 79th highest crime rate of 430 local areas in Teignbridge .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 48.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-65.6%.

Employment

TQ12 1EY area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
